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K Current Report was filed by The Lovesac Company (LOVE) on July 29, 2024. The filing discloses the entry into a material definitive agreement regarding the company's credit facility and the authorization of a new share repurchase program.
Key Financial Metrics and Agreements
Credit Facility Amendment
- Facility Size: Maximum revolver commitment remains at $40.0 million.
- Accordion Feature: Added an uncommitted option to increase the facility size by up to $10 million.
- Maturity Date: Extended from September 30, 2024, to July 29, 2029.
- Sublimits: $1.0 million for letters of credit; $4.0 million for swing line loans.
- Interest Rates: Base rate plus 0.50% to 0.75% margin, or SOFR plus 1.625% to 1.875% margin, based on excess availability.
- Commitment Fee: 0.30% on the daily unused portion.
- Covenants: Requires maintenance of undrawn availability of at least 10% of the lesser of aggregate commitments or the borrowing base.
- Collateral: Secured by a first lien on substantially all company assets.
Share Repurchase Authorization
- Authorization Amount: Up to $40 million in shares of outstanding common stock.
- Authorization Date: June 11, 2024.
- Execution: Timing, manner, price, and amount are at management's discretion via open market, private negotiations, or accelerated share repurchases.
Material Changes Versus Prior Period
The primary material change is the extension of the credit facility maturity date by approximately five years (from late 2024 to late 2029), providing significant additional liquidity runway. Additionally, the company has introduced a new $40 million share repurchase authorization, which represents a new capital allocation strategy not present in the prior comparable period.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
The filing contains forward-looking statements regarding the company's plans for share repurchases and the implementation of the credit amendment. Management noted that actual results could differ materially due to market conditions, global economic factors, and the company's ability to execute its plans. The filing explicitly disclaims any obligation to update these forward-looking statements. Proceeds from the credit facility may be used for working capital, capital expenditures, share repurchases, and refinancing indebtedness.
